The Role of Liquid in Pressure Cooking
Liquid plays a crucial role in pressure cooking, serving several key functions. First and foremost, liquid helps to create the steam that drives the pressure cooking process. As the liquid heats up, it turns into steam, which then builds up pressure inside the cooker. This pressure is what allows food to cook more quickly and efficiently than other cooking methods. Additionally, liquid helps to distribute heat evenly throughout the cooker, ensuring that food is cooked consistently. Finally, liquid can also add flavor to dishes, as it can be used to create rich and savory sauces or broths.

Consequences of Insufficient Liquid
If there is not enough liquid in the pressure cooker, it can lead to a range of problems, including safety hazards and subpar cooking results. Some of the potential consequences of insufficient liquid include:
| Consequence | Description |
|---|---|
| Burned or Scorching | Food can become burned or scorched if there is not enough liquid to distribute heat evenly. |
| Undercooked Food | Insufficient liquid can prevent food from cooking properly, leading to undercooked or raw areas. |
| Pressure Cooker Damage | Running a pressure cooker with insufficient liquid can cause damage to the cooker itself, including warped or cracked lids and bent or broken seals. |
| Safety Hazards | In extreme cases, insufficient liquid can cause the pressure cooker to overheat, leading to a potentially catastrophic failure of the cooker. |

How can I prevent scorching or food from sticking to the bottom of the pressure cooker?
Preventing scorching or food from sticking to the bottom of the pressure cooker is crucial to ensuring safe and effective operation. One of the most effective ways to prevent scorching is to use the recommended amount of liquid, as this will help to create a layer of steam that prevents the food from coming into contact with the bottom of the pot. Additionally, it is recommended to brown or sauté foods before adding liquid, as this can help to create a flavorful crust that prevents the food from sticking.
Another way to prevent scorching is to use a trivet or steamer basket, which can help to elevate the food above the bottom of the pot and prevent it from coming into contact with the heat source. It is also essential to stir the food regularly during cooking, especially when using a thick or sticky sauce.
